Browns’ Mini-Camp: Five Things to Watch

1. Deshaun Watson’s Health and Progress

* Watson has been throwing for three months and all reports indicate a positive recovery. * Expected to increase workload during mini-camp. * Provide an update on his health and readiness for training camp.

2. Amari Cooper’s Contract Situation

* Cooper skipped voluntary OTAs and faces questions about an extension request. * Could give insights into his motivations and the team’s plans. * Offers a glimpse of the Browns’ wide receiver depth chart alongside Jerry Jeudy.

3. Myles Garrett’s Outlook

* After winning Defensive Player of the Year, Garrett will share his thoughts on his mindset and goals. * Provides an opportunity to assess his impact on the team’s championship aspirations. * Scrutiny on his production in the latter stages of seasons.

4. Return of Notable Players

* Joel Bitonio, Dalvin Tomlinson, Quinton Jefferson, Juan Thornhill, and Dustin Hopkins will participate after missing OTAs. * Jefferson’s presence will provide depth to the interior defensive line. * Health updates on Bitonio, Thornhill, and Hopkins.

5. Injury Status

* Nick Chubb, Jack Conklin, and Nyheim Hines remain out with ACL injuries. * Jedrick Wills Jr. expected to return to practice after missing OTAs with an MCL injury. * Dorian Thompson-Robinson’s recovery progress.
